Black Eyed Peas’ Peapod Foundation to Host Concert

by Lynn on January 17th, 2008

The Peapod FoundationThe Black Eyed Peas’ Peapod Foundation will be performing in the fourth annual Peapod Foundation Benefit Concert at the Avalon in Hollywood on February 7. The concert will be a fund-raiser for the Peapod Music and Arts Academy that opened its doors earlier this month at the Watts/Willowbrook Boys & Girls Club. The academy offers a year-round after-school and weekend program for about 50 kids living in foster care. The facility features state-of-the-art audio and video equipment as well as dance instruction. It’s designed to help kids pursue careers in the entertainment business.

The academy is funded by the Black Eyed Peas’ Peapod Foundation, which is administered by the Entertainment Industry Foundation. The group’s goal is to expand the academy program to other cities around the country.
